.TH MAXPASSWD "1" "August 2024" "maxpasswd " "User Commands" .SH NAME maxpasswd .SH SYNOPSIS .B maxpasswd [\fI\,-h|--help\/\fR] [\fI\,-i|--interactive\/\fR] [\fI\,-d|--decrypt\/\fR] [\fI\,path\/\fR] \fI\,password\/\fR .SH DESCRIPTION Encrypt a MaxScale plaintext password using the encryption key in the key file \&'.secrets'. The key file may be generated using the 'maxkeys'\-utility. .TP \fB\-h\fR, \fB\-\-help\fR Display this help. .TP \fB\-d\fR, \fB\-\-decrypt\fR Decrypt an encrypted password instead. .TP \fB\-i\fR, \fB\-\-interactive\fR \- If maxpasswd is reading from a pipe, it will read a line and use that as the password. .TP \- If maxpasswd is connected to a terminal console, it will prompt for the password. .TP If '\-i' is specified, a single argument is assumed to be the path and two arguments is treated like an error. .TP path The key file directory (default: '/home/markusjm/build\-develop/data/lib/maxscale') .TP password The password to encrypt or decrypt
